HOME COUNTRY: It was like buzzards circling the body.

By Slim Randles | CNBNews ContributorSLIM

It was like buzzards circling the body.

  The Jones kid, Randy, was out in the Mule Barn coffee shop parking lot with the hood up on his car. He was staring down into it the way a first-time parachutist would look out the airplane door. You never quite knew for sure what lay ahead.

  “Looks like Randy’s got problems,” said Steve.

  “Let’s have a look,” said Dud.

  So coffee was left to get cold and the entire Supreme Court of All Things Mechanical – Steve, Dud, Doc, Herb and Dewey – trooped out to see what was going on.

  They formed a powerful semi-circle of wisdom around the youth and his engine with folded arms and facial expressions that said, “It’s okay, Kid. We’re here.”

  Dewey spoke first. “Having trouble, Randy?”

   “Won’t start.”

   Doc, who has the most initials after his name, said, “Give it a try.”

   Randy ground the engine, but it wouldn’t kick over.

   “Stop! Stop!” Doc yelled. “Don’t want to flood it.”

   All Doc knows about flooding is that the animals went on board, two by two.

   “Randy, I think it’s the solenoid,” said Steve, looking wise. And of course he pronounced it sell-a-noid. 

   “Doesn’t have one, Steve,” Randy said.

   “Sure it does. All cars have solenoids.”

   “Not the new ones. Haven’t made solenoids in years.”

   Steve’s expression said, “Young punks, what do they know?” But his voice said, “Well, what do you know about that?”

   “Need a jump?” Dewey asked.

   “Got plenty of spark,” Randy said. 

   Randy looked at the older men and then bent to the engine and smiled. His voice came floating up over the radiator. “Might be the junction fibrillator. Or it could be a malfunction of the Johnson switch. If I rerun the wire from the organ housing to the pump by-pass, that might get it done.”

When Randy looked up, all the men had gone back in for coffee. He smile and called Triple A on his cell phone.

2025 Down and Derby Wine Festival

On Saturday,  May 3, the Camden County Board of Commissioners and Visit South Jersey will host their fifth annual Down and Derby Wine Festival on Veterans Island at Cooper River Park.

During the event, which will run from 2 p.m. to 7 p.m., visitors can sample local wines from 20 of South Jersey’s leading wine producers while immersing themselves in Derby themed fashion and festivities. The event will also feature food trucks, games and live performances by the Lally Brothers Band and Goodman Fiske Band.

“The Down and Derby Wine Festival showcases all of the wonderful food and wine offerings the South Jersey region has to offer,” Commissioner Jeffrey Nash said. “Each year, this event becomes more and more popular, so we invite all of our residents to join us at Veterans Island for a day full of delicious wine, local food and live music.”

The Board of Commissioners is partnering with Visit South Jersey (VSJ) to host the event. Visit South Jersey is the official destination marketing organization for Burlington, Camden, Gloucester and Salem counties, and the Outer Coastal Plain Wine Region in South Jersey. VSJ is a non-profit organization supported in part by a grant from the New Jersey Department of State, Division of Travel and Tourism.

“Every year, the Down & Derby Wine Festival grows bigger and better,” said Michael P. Snyder, director of operations for Visit South Jersey. “This year’s lineup of wineries and entertainment sets the bar even higher, and we can’t wait to show visitors why South Jersey is a premier destination for wine and culture.”

America Can’t Afford to Play Favorites in the Quest for Energy Independence

By Kent Bartley

President Trump has made energy independence a pillar of his second-term agenda. Within hours of taking office, he declared a National Energy Emergency and signed executive orders to accelerate domestic oil and gas production.

His message was clear. America must no longer rely on foreign energy. But securing true energy independence will require more than just drilling. Our nation needs to unleash every viable American-made energy resource — both fossil fuels and renewables. 

Indeed, President Trump has an opportunity to redefine energy dominance — not by choosing sides but by embracing an energy strategy that is as resilient as the country it powers.

That resilience is going to be tested. By one estimate, domestic electricity consumption will increase nearly 16% by 2029 — a drastic acceleration compared with the past two decades, when demand crept up by just 0.5% annually.

Meeting this surge won’t be easy, what with wars, supply chain disruptions, and energy price swings threatening to upend global markets on a seemingly daily basis.

Plenty of domestic energy resources are hiding in plain sight. Each year, the United States throws away up to 40% of its food supply. Much of it ends up in landfills, where it rots and releases methane, a greenhouse gas more potent than carbon dioxide.

That rot represents energy wasted. Anaerobic digestion can capture it — and allow us to put it to good use. 

Dairy farms are already deploying this strategy. Instead of letting manure from their cows pile up and release methane into the atmosphere, the farm feeds it into an anaerobic digester. Microbes break down the organic matter. The result is biogas, a powerful renewable fuel that can generate electricity, heat water, or even be refined into a pipeline-ready fuel that integrates seamlessly into the existing natural gas infrastructure.

The remaining material — called digestate — is transformed into a natural fertilizer that enriches the soil without synthetic chemicals.

The United States has plenty of waste beyond cow manure for fueling anaerobic digestion. Food waste, farm byproducts, and other organic materials are being discarded every day. Diverting even a fraction of that waste from landfills could deliver a serious boost to our energy security. 

For too long, energy policy in the United States has waffled between favoring fossil fuels and favoring renewables. But that’s the wrong dichotomy. There’s widespread consensus that domestic energy is superior to foreign-sourced energy. That principle should be our guiding light.

Across the country, companies are pioneering breakthroughs in tidal power, green hydrogen, advanced geothermal energy, and next-generation solar cells. These innovations don’t compete with traditional energy sources. They reinforce and strengthen them. They can secure America’s energy independence and make the entire system more durable in the face of geopolitical instability. 

Energy independence will not be won by choosing sides but by embracing every American energy resource that moves us toward that goal.

Kent Bartley is the president of the organic solutions division at Vanguard Renewables. This piece originally ran in the International Business Times

Online Gambling in the U.S.: Debunking the Myths and Understanding the Realities

Online gambling has become one of the most discussed and misunderstood topics in American culture over the past decade. As more states explore legalization, regulation, and taxation of digital wagering platforms—including sports betting, casino games, and poker—public opinion remains split. Fueled by media portrayals and long-standing stigmas, many Americans still operate under misconceptions about what online gambling entails and who participates in it.

In this article, we’ll separate myth from reality to shed light on what online gambling will really look like in 2025 and what that means for individuals, lawmakers, and communities across the United States.

Myth #1: Online Gambling Is Illegal in the U.S.

Reality: Online gambling is legal in many U.S. states—under the right conditions.

A common myth is that all online gambling is illegal in the United States. The truth is more nuanced. Online gambling legality varies by state. Some states like New Jersey, Pennsylvania, and Michigan have fully regulated markets that include online casinos, poker, and sports betting. Others, such as Utah and Texas, have stricter laws prohibiting most forms of online gambling.

At the federal level, the Unlawful Internet Gambling Enforcement Act (UIGEA) of 2006 restricts certain financial transactions related to illegal online gambling—but it doesn’t outright ban gambling itself. Instead, UIGEA leaves it up to individual states to regulate or prohibit digital wagering within their own borders.

For example, residents in New Jersey can access licensed platforms where they can safely find poker rooms online and participate legally. This is a growing trend, not an outlier.

Top Features to Look for in Board Management Software

In today’s fast-paced digital landscape, board meetings have evolved beyond traditional paper-based processes. Board management software has become an essential tool for modern governance, streamlining everything from meeting preparation to secure document sharing. But with so many options on the market, how do you choose the right one? 

Whether you’re part of a corporate board, nonprofit, or educational institution, the right software can save time, reduce costs, and improve decision-making. Here are the top features to look for when selecting board management software.

User-Friendly Interface

One of the most important aspects of any software is ease of use. Board members often have varying levels of tech proficiency, so your board management solution should be intuitive and straightforward. Look for software with a clean interface, easy navigation, and minimal learning curve. Dashboards that summarize upcoming meetings, tasks, and recent documents are particularly helpful.

Robust Security

Board-level discussions often involve confidential and sensitive information. The software must offer enterprise-grade security features including:

  • End-to-end encryption
  • Multi-factor authentication
  • Granular user permissions
  • Compliance with industry standards like GDPR, SOC 2, and HIPAA

Make sure the provider has a strong security policy and regular third-party audits to protect your data.
